The most suitable time for chimney cleaning in Kentucky is typically during the late spring or summer. This allows for the service to be completed before the peak usage of the fall and winter heating seasons. Scheduling in advance ensures your chimney is ready for colder weather.
A professional chimney cleaning in Kentucky generally takes between one and two hours. This includes a thorough inspection of the chimney flue, the removal of soot and creosote, and a final safety check. More complex chimney structures may require additional time.
For most homes in Kentucky, an annual chimney cleaning and inspection is recommended. This frequency is vital for preventing dangerous creosote buildup and ensuring the safe operation of your fireplace or wood stove during the cold winter months.
Fire departments in Kentucky generally do not offer chimney cleaning services. Their focus is on emergency response. For routine cleaning and inspection, it is necessary to hire a professional and insured chimney sweep.

Kentucky does not have a statewide licensing requirement for chimney sweeps. However, local municipalities like Louisville/Jefferson County may have specific business licensing ordinances. We operate with the necessary professional credentials and insurance to serve you.
